.Footer-module-scss-module__wcgw9G__Footer{border-top:solid 1px var(--color-border);text-align:center;padding-top:32px;padding-bottom:32px}.Footer-module-scss-module__wcgw9G__inner{gap:20px;display:grid}.Footer-module-scss-module__wcgw9G__subscribe{flex-direction:column;justify-content:center;align-items:center;gap:20px;padding-bottom:20px;display:flex}.Footer-module-scss-module__wcgw9G__subscribe__description{width:100%;max-width:34em}.Footer-module-scss-module__wcgw9G__subscribe__form{width:100%;max-width:500px}@media (max-width:768px){.Footer-module-scss-module__wcgw9G__navPrimary{font-size:clamp(.75rem,4.444vw,1.25rem);line-height:1.3125;font-family:var(--default-font-family);font-weight:400}}@media (min-width:769px){.Footer-module-scss-module__wcgw9G__navPrimary{font-size:clamp(.6875rem,1.25vw,1.375rem);line-height:1.38889;font-family:var(--default-font-family);font-weight:400}}.Footer-module-scss-module__wcgw9G__navPrimary{flex-wrap:wrap;justify-content:center;gap:1em;display:flex}.Footer-module-scss-module__wcgw9G__navPrimary__link{text-decoration:none;transition:color .15s}.Footer-module-scss-module__wcgw9G__navPrimary__link[href]:hover{color:var(--color-highlight)}@media (max-width:768px){.Footer-module-scss-module__wcgw9G__legal{font-size:clamp(.625rem,3.611vw,1rem);line-height:1.53846;font-family:var(--default-font-family);font-weight:400}}@media (min-width:769px){.Footer-module-scss-module__wcgw9G__legal{font-size:clamp(.5rem,.903vw,1rem);line-height:1.53846;font-family:var(--default-font-family);font-weight:400}}.Footer-module-scss-module__wcgw9G__legal{color:var(--color-gray-60);flex-wrap:wrap;justify-content:center;gap:1em;display:flex}.Footer-module-scss-module__wcgw9G__legal a{text-decoration:none}.Footer-module-scss-module__wcgw9G__legal a:hover{color:var(--color-highlight)}
.Ticker-module-scss-module__0sayHa__Ticker{height:var(--ticker-height);background-color:var(--color-black);color:var(--color-white);z-index:var(--z-index-ticker);position:relative}@media (max-width:768px){.Ticker-module-scss-module__0sayHa__Ticker{font-size:clamp(.4375rem,2.5vw,.6875rem);line-height:1.22222;font-family:var(--default-font-family);font-weight:400}}@media (min-width:769px){.Ticker-module-scss-module__0sayHa__Ticker{font-size:clamp(.375rem,.694vw,.75rem);line-height:1.2;font-family:var(--default-font-family);font-weight:400}}.Ticker-module-scss-module__0sayHa__Ticker a{white-space:nowrap;text-decoration:none;display:inline;position:relative}.Ticker-module-scss-module__0sayHa__Ticker a:before{content:"";will-change:transform;transform-origin:0 100%;border-bottom:1px solid;transition:transform .4s cubic-bezier(.165,.84,.44,1),opacity .4s cubic-bezier(.165,.84,.44,1);display:block;position:absolute;bottom:0;left:0;right:0}.Ticker-module-scss-module__0sayHa__Ticker a{transition:color .2s}.Ticker-module-scss-module__0sayHa__Ticker a:before{opacity:.5}.Ticker-module-scss-module__0sayHa__marquee{width:100%;height:100%;position:absolute;top:0;left:0}.Ticker-module-scss-module__0sayHa__part{padding-left:1em;position:relative}
.Navbar-module-scss-module__N8yoJa__Navbar{width:100%;z-index:var(--z-index-header);color:var(--color-black);pointer-events:none;position:fixed;top:0;left:0}.Navbar-module-scss-module__N8yoJa__outer{will-change:transform;pointer-events:auto;position:relative}.Navbar-module-scss-module__N8yoJa__main{background-color:var(--color-white);transition:box-shadow .5s;box-shadow:0 1px #00000080}.Navbar-module-scss-module__N8yoJa__inner{height:var(--navbar-height);background-color:var(--color-white);align-items:center;gap:68px;display:flex;position:relative}@media (max-width:960px){.Navbar-module-scss-module__N8yoJa__inner{justify-content:space-between}.Navbar-module-scss-module__N8yoJa__logo{z-index:1;flex-direction:column;justify-content:center;align-items:center;height:100%;margin-left:-24px;display:flex;position:absolute;top:0;left:50%}}.Navbar-module-scss-module__N8yoJa__logo__link{border-radius:2px;justify-content:center;align-items:center;margin-left:-6px;margin-right:-6px;padding:6px;display:flex}.Navbar-module-scss-module__N8yoJa__logo__svg{width:48px;height:auto;transition:fill .3s}.Navbar-module-scss-module__N8yoJa__logo__svg *{fill:currentColor}@media (hover:hover) and (pointer:fine){.Navbar-module-scss-module__N8yoJa__logo:hover .Navbar-module-scss-module__N8yoJa__logo__svg *{fill:var(--color-highlight)}}.Navbar-module-scss-module__N8yoJa__nav{flex-grow:1}@media print{.Navbar-module-scss-module__N8yoJa__nav{display:none}}.Navbar-module-scss-module__N8yoJa__nav__list{align-items:center;gap:1.75em;display:flex;position:relative}@media (max-width:768px){.Navbar-module-scss-module__N8yoJa__nav__list{font-size:clamp(.9375rem,4.444vw,1.125rem);line-height:1.3125;font-family:var(--default-font-family);font-weight:400}}@media (min-width:769px){.Navbar-module-scss-module__N8yoJa__nav__list{font-size:clamp(1rem,1.25vw,1.25rem);line-height:1.38889;font-family:var(--default-font-family);font-weight:400}}.Navbar-module-scss-module__N8yoJa__link{-webkit-user-select:none;user-select:none;border-radius:2px;margin-left:-5px;margin-right:-5px;padding:5px;text-decoration:none;transition:color .15s;display:block}.Navbar-module-scss-module__N8yoJa__link[aria-current=true],.Navbar-module-scss-module__N8yoJa__link[aria-current=page]{color:var(--color-gray-60)}@media (pointer:fine){.Navbar-module-scss-module__N8yoJa__link:hover{color:var(--color-highlight)}}
.PageTransition-module-scss-module__WllU4G__overlay{z-index:var(--z-index-page-transition);background-color:var(--color-white);opacity:0;pointer-events:none;position:fixed;inset:0}
.ResizeService-module-scss-module__x_j9hW__loading{z-index:99999;background-color:#fff;width:100%;height:100%;position:fixed;top:0;left:0}.ResizeService-module-scss-module__x_j9hW__measure{width:0;height:0;position:absolute;top:0;left:0;overflow:hidden}.ResizeService-module-scss-module__x_j9hW__measureVh{height:100vh;position:absolute;top:0;left:0}.ResizeService-module-scss-module__x_j9hW__measureVw{width:100vw;position:absolute;top:0;left:0}.ResizeService-module-scss-module__x_j9hW__measureLvh{height:100lvh;position:absolute;top:0;left:0}.ResizeService-module-scss-module__x_j9hW__measureSvh{height:100svh;position:absolute;top:0;left:0}
